would cheap energy club still save me money if my readings from month to month are?

I decided to go through the sign up process for cheap energy club. When it came to input my usage I went into both my gas, and electricity accounts, and firstly the usage history is displayed in 3 month chunks not month to month. Secondly due to both my mum and I being people with health problems our usage varies wildly from each of those 3 month chunks.

So could the cheap energy club still save us money even with wildly different usage from month to month?

Also one thing we would want in regards to the gas is the option of a service contract we currently have one with our current supplier British Gas as having the hot water is important.

    You should just put in your typical annual usage - with your varying usage it (I assume) is still high so you will not gain from flitting over summer. You may want to check each fuel on a separate tariff as there may be savings there.

    There is no need for a service contract for your boiler - contact a plumber if it breaks down. It isn't going to be any slower and is likely to be far cheaper (as little as zero pounds for years on end.)

    The posts from Nada666 and JJ Egan should help you with this - I'd agree, if your usage fluctuates as you describe, it is definitely best to provide you usage over the course of a year (ideally in kwh as this is more accurate than providing your DD figure).

    Just add the 4 (3 month) blocks together and you will have 1 years worth of usage.
